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ender

Forumthread: Änderungsdatum der Datei in Zelle anzeigen

Änderungsdatum der Datei in Zelle anzeigen
13.10.2006 23:12:27
Christian
Hallo zusammen,
gibt es eine Moeglichkeit bzw. eine Formel mir das letzte Aenderungsdatum einer Excel Arbeitsmappe in einer bestimmten Zelle dieser Arbeitsmappe anzeigen zu lassen?
Vielen Dank
Christian
Anzeige

2
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Änderungsdatum der Datei in Zelle anzeigen
14.10.2006 05:10:49
fcs
Hallo Christian,
geht meines Wissens nur mit einer benutzerdefinierten Funktion, die du im VBA-Editor in ein Modul einfügen muss.

Function LastSaved() As Date
Application.Volatile
LastSaved = VBA.FileDateTime(ThisWorkbook.Path & "\" & ThisWorkbook.Name)
End Function

Gruss
Franz
Anzeige
AW: Änderungsdatum der Datei in Zelle anzeigen
16.10.2006 16:50:44
Christian
Hallo Franz,
vielen dank. Werde ich gleich ausprobieren.
Christian
;

Forumthreads zu verwandten Themen

Anzeige
Anzeige
Entdecke relevante Threads

Schau dir verwandte Threads basierend auf dem aktuellen Thema an

Alle relevanten Threads mit Inhaltsvorschau entdecken
Anzeige
Anzeige

Infobox / Tutorial

Änderungsdatum der Datei in Zelle anzeigen


Schritt-für-Schritt-Anleitung

Um das Änderungsdatum einer Excel-Arbeitsmappe in einer bestimmten Zelle anzuzeigen, kannst du die folgende benutzerdefinierte Funktion im VBA-Editor verwenden:

  1. Öffne Excel und drücke ALT + F11, um den VBA-Editor zu öffnen.

  2. Klicke auf Einfügen > Modul, um ein neues Modul zu erstellen.

  3. Füge den folgenden Code ein:

    Function LastSaved() As Date
       Application.Volatile
       LastSaved = VBA.FileDateTime(ThisWorkbook.Path & "\" & ThisWorkbook.Name)
    End Function
  4. Schließe den VBA-Editor und kehre zu deiner Excel-Tabelle zurück.

  5. Nun kannst du diese Funktion in einer Zelle verwenden. Gib einfach =LastSaved() ein, um das Datum der letzten Speicherung anzuzeigen.


Häufige Fehler und Lösungen

  • Fehler: Die Zelle zeigt #NAME? an.

    • Lösung: Stelle sicher, dass die Funktion richtig eingegeben wurde und dass du im richtigen Arbeitsblatt bist.
  • Fehler: Das Datum aktualisiert sich nicht.

    • Lösung: Die Funktion nutzt Application.Volatile, aber du kannst auch die Arbeitsmappe speichern oder F9 drücken, um eine Aktualisierung zu erzwingen.

Alternative Methoden

Falls du das Änderungsdatum ohne VBA anzeigen möchtest, gibt es leider keine direkte Möglichkeit, dies zu tun. Du kannst jedoch das Datum der letzten Speicherung manuell in eine Zelle eintragen oder ein Makro erstellen, das diese Information aktualisiert.

Eine alternative Methode könnte auch sein, das PDF-Erstelldatum auszulesen, wenn du die Datei als PDF exportierst:

  1. Speichere die Datei als PDF.
  2. Nutze ein PDF-Tool, um das Erstelldatum auszulesen.

Praktische Beispiele

Wenn du beispielsweise das letzte Änderungsdatum in Zelle A1 einfügen möchtest, gehe wie folgt vor:

  1. Führe die Schritte aus der Schritt-für-Schritt-Anleitung aus.
  2. Klicke in Zelle A1 und tippe =LastSaved().
  3. Du siehst nun das Datum der letzten Speicherung in Zelle A1.

Tipps für Profis

  • Verwende die Funktion =LastSaved() in Kombination mit anderen Funktionen, um das Datum in einem bestimmten Format anzuzeigen. Beispiel:

    =TEXT(LastSaved(), "TT.MM.JJJJ")
  • Um das Änderungsdatum einer Zelle anzuzeigen, müsstest du ein weiteres Makro schreiben, das diese Information trackt, da Excel keine eingebaute Funktion dafür hat.


FAQ: Häufige Fragen

1. Kann ich das Änderungsdatum auch für eine bestimmte Zelle anzeigen?
Leider gibt es dafür keine direkte Funktion in Excel. Du müsstest VBA verwenden, um das Änderungsdatum einer Zelle zu verfolgen.

2. Was ist der Unterschied zwischen dem Änderungsdatum und dem Datum der letzten Speicherung?
Das Änderungsdatum bezieht sich auf die letzte Modifikation der Datei, während das Datum der letzten Speicherung das letzte Mal angibt, als die Datei gespeichert wurde.

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Entdecke mehr
Finde genau, was du suchst

Die erweiterte Suchfunktion hilft dir, gezielt die besten Antworten zu finden

Suche nach den besten Antworten
Unsere beliebtesten Threads

Entdecke unsere meistgeklickten Beiträge in der Google Suche

Top 100 Threads jetzt ansehen
Anzeige